Hot-dip galvanized steel pipes are a popular choice in construction and various industrial applications due to their superior durability and resistance to corrosion. These pipes undergo a process where steel is immersed in molten zinc to form a protective layer that significantly enhances their lifespan. One of the most significant advantages of hot-dip galvanized steel pipes is their extended service life. According to studies, galvanized steel has a lifespan of up to 50 years or more in outdoor environments and can reach 25 years when used underground. The protective zinc coating effectively prevents rust and degradation, making these pipes an excellent investment for long-term projects.
Another benefit is the cost-effectiveness of hot-dip galvanization. A report by the American Galvanizers Association (AGA) indicates that the initial costs associated with hot-dip galvanized welded steel pipe are offset by the reduced maintenance and replacement expenses over time. In comparison to pipes that are not galvanized, the maintenance savings can be as much as 50%. This reduction in lifecycle costs is crucial for organizations looking to enhance their budget efficiency.
The corrosion resistance provided by hot-dip galvanized steel is exceptional. According to a study published in the Journal of Materials Engineering and Performance, hot-dip galvanized steel exhibits superior resistance to several corrosive environments, including sewage and marine applications. This resilience ensures that the integrity of the steel is maintained even in harsh conditions, which is why it is often used in both industrial and municipal infrastructure projects.
